c programming assignment help for Dummies

This spawns a thread per message, and the run_list is presumably managed to wipe out People responsibilities the moment These are finished.

The fact that the code is a mess considerably raises the work required to make any alter and the potential risk of introducing glitches.

On the other hand, if failing for making a link is taken into account an mistake, then a failure must throw an exception.

Typically you might want to increase and take away factors within the container, so use vector by default; when you don’t require to switch the container’s dimension, use array.

An interpreter executes straight the significant level language. It can be interactive but operates slower than compiled code. Numerous languages could be compiled or interpreted. The initial Primary (Novice's All-purpose Symbolic Instruction Code) was interpreted. What this means is the person typed application to the computer, as well as the interpreter executed the instructions as they have been typed.

No. These rules are about how to greatest use Regular C++fourteen (and, In case you have an implementation available, the Ideas Specialized Specification) and write code assuming you do have a fashionable conforming compiler.

They are meant to inhibit completely valid C++ code that correlates my site with problems, spurious complexity, and inadequate functionality.

Detect that the line review area=facet; results in two copies of the data. The first price continues to be in aspect, while spot also incorporates this worth. As described previously mentioned, variables have a sort (Desk five.three), and also the expression on the proper of the assignment assertion must evaluate to your price of that very same type. If facet has the value 3, the expression facet*facet evaluates to the nine, along with the 9 is saved to the variable location. The printf is accustomed to output the results towards the uart port.

If there is no clear resource manage and for many purpose defining an appropriate RAII item/handle is infeasible,

Importantly, the rules assist gradual adoption: It is often infeasible to absolutely transform a considerable code foundation unexpectedly.

Deallocation capabilities, such as specially overloaded operator delete and operator delete[], slide in the same category, since they far too are utilised throughout cleanup generally, and during exception dealing with specifically, to again away from partial operate that needs to be undone.

These intelligent pointers match the Shared_ptr idea, so these guideline enforcement guidelines work on them out from the box and expose this frequent pessimization.

Forgetting a circumstance typically happens when a circumstance is added to an enumeration and the person doing so Extra resources fails to add it to each

Resolution: This instance illustrates a common trait of an embedded program, that may be, they perform the identical set of tasks repeatedly for good. The program starts off at primary when electric power is used, and also the program behaves like a toaster right until it is unplugged. Figure 5.three demonstrates a flowchart for 1 achievable toaster algorithm.

Leave a Reply

Your email address will not be published. Required fields are marked *